Semaglutide vs. tirzepatide & the GLP-1 options

Brand-name and compounded options available to St. Joseph patients

ShotMoleculeApproved forFrequencyTypical price
Ozempic Semaglutide Type 2 diabetes (off-label weight loss) Once weekly $950–$1,350/mo
Wegovy Semaglutide Chronic weight management Once weekly $1,300–$1,400/mo
Mounjaro Tirzepatide Type 2 diabetes (off-label weight loss) Once weekly $1,000–$1,200/mo
Zepbound Tirzepatide Chronic weight management Once weekly $1,000–$1,060/mo
Compounded Semaglutide / Tirzepatide Cash-pay telehealth option Once weekly $199–$499/mo

Prices are typical U.S. cash-pay ranges without insurance; manufacturer savings cards and coverage can lower brand-name costs significantly.

What to expect: dosing & side effects

GLP-1 medications are given as a once-weekly subcutaneous injection, starting at a low dose that your provider increases gradually over several weeks to limit side effects. Most St. Joseph patients self-inject at home after a short demonstration.

The most common side effects are nausea, diarrhea, constipation, decreased appetite and mild injection-site reactions — usually mild and fading over the first few weeks. Rare but serious risks include pancreatitis, gallbladder issues and thyroid concerns; GLP-1s should not be used by people with a personal or family history of medullary thyroid carcinoma or MEN 2. Your provider reviews your full history before prescribing.

Semaglutide (Ozempic, Wegovy) targets one receptor and averages ~15% weight loss; tirzepatide (Mounjaro, Zepbound) targets two receptors and reaches up to ~22.5%. Tirzepatide is generally more effective but costs more. A St. Joseph provider helps you choose.

Brand-name shots run about $1,000–$1,400/month without insurance in St. Joseph. Compounded semaglutide or tirzepatide via telehealth starts around $199/month all-inclusive. With Wisconsin insurance coverage, copays can be as low as $25–$50.

Most people notice reduced appetite within the first week or two, with meaningful weight loss over months. Trials showed ~5–10% loss by three months. Providers in St. Joseph start you at a low dose and increase gradually, so results build steadily rather than overnight.

To qualify for a GLP-1 in St. Joseph you typically need a BMI of 30 or higher, or 27 or higher with a weight-related condition such as hypertension, type 2 diabetes, or high cholesterol. A free online assessment with a licensed Wisconsin provider confirms your eligibility in minutes.

Some weight regain is common after stopping, with patients often regaining a portion within a year. Providers usually recommend gradual tapering and building sustainable habits while on the medication. Your St. Joseph provider can design a long-term or maintenance plan.

Brand-name GLP-1s come as prefilled pens (pre-measured, very easy to use). Compounded medication often ships as a vial with syringes, which costs less and lets the provider fine-tune the dose. Both deliver the same weekly subcutaneous injection; your St. Joseph provider will recommend what fits you.
